About the position

The Snack Bar Attendant position is responsible for operating various food and beverage service areas within the casino, including the Burger Bar, Slice N Dice, TDR, and Coffee Shop. This role emphasizes exceptional customer service, cash handling, and adherence to safety and sanitation guidelines. The attendant must maintain a professional demeanor while providing prompt and courteous service to guests.
